Why this album works
'Think About Love' features remixed versions of several earlier hits, showcasing Parton's adaptability to the changing sounds of the music industry. The album solidified her presence on pop charts, reflecting the growing popularity of crossover artists in the mid-1980s.

- Context
- By 1986, Dolly Parton was enjoying significant mainstream success following her crossover hits in the late '70s and early '80s. 'Think About Love' came after her acclaimed album 'Heartbreak Express' and showcased her continued evolution as a pop-oriented artist, while still rooted in country traditions.
